Ways to Keep Workplaces Free From Germs
Also known as germicidal irradiation, UV disinfection methods use UV light to eliminate germs by destroying their DNA and nucleic acids. Apart from being effective, the method is non-toxic and very affordable.

Upper Room Disinfection
Upper rooms are prone to airborne pathogens and viruses and require disinfection. If you have this concern, you should opt for cleaning methods like upper room germicidal UV. This option involves the use of luminaire lamps that emit UV rays.
The emission of UV-C rays disinfects the upper room air, eliminating all viruses and bacteria. Upper room germicidal UV does not get rid of other particles from the air but makes them non-infectious.
There are several considerations for this type of disinfection. One of them is the number of people occupying the space. Diseases and infections can become life-threatening if the room gets crowded with people, so providing upper room disinfection methods is vital.
Ventilation is another key consideration when using upper room disinfection. All spaces must have adequate natural ventilation for proper air circulation. The ceiling’s height also matters when installing UV germicidal systems.
HVAC System Airstream Disinfection
This method uses UV air disinfection units. These UV-C fixtures get installed in the HVAC ductwork to eliminate all active microorganisms. The moving air in the air distribution systems also gets disinfected by the UV fixtures.
Here, disinfection happens before the circulating air gets distributed into a room. The installation of the UV fixtures on the ductwork lessens the severity of the emitted radiations.
Properly test the UV system for disinfection. This is necessary to ensure that all the targeted disinfection rates are met.
The intensity of the UV-C is also an important factor to consider. This depends on the susceptibility of the targeted microbes to UV radiation (UV-C). Intense UV-C is necessary when there are many pathogens in an HVAC system.
Equipment and Surface Disinfection
Surface disinfection is common in laboratories and health care facilities. Equipment like countertops, office desks, laboratory instruments, and others host many germs and viruses. Exposing these surfaces to UV-C is key to keeping them free from unwanted microbes.
Compared to washing and other cleaning methods, UV technology is much simpler. One doesn’t have to spend time and energy washing and drying the equipment. Harsh cleaning chemicals can also discolor and harm important equipment. UV germicidal irradiation safety systems easily eliminate germs while protecting all equipment from fading and other damage.
UV disinfection methods can eliminate germs on the floor and wall surfaces. The reflectors in your luminaire lamps must provide uniform surface radiation for efficient and effective disinfection.
Water and Food Disinfection
Water and food disinfection is another way of eliminating microbes in homes and workplaces. This method is much safer and more thorough than water chemical treatments. UV light is best for eliminating giardia and other chemical-resistant parasites.
Food production facilities also require food and beverage disinfection to eliminate unwanted germs. UV light can easily disinfect hard-to-clean production equipment like conveyor belts.
